Discover the book that started a revolution! In Happy Calories Don't Count (neither does unhappy exercise) weight-loss expert, Carmela Ramaglia, reveals her own struggle with diet and exercise and the amazing experiences which led her to challenge the traditional "diet and exercise" model for weight-loss. Weaving a tapestry of hope for those struggling with issues around food and exercise and the pain these obsessions inflict, Carmela eloquently blends the reality of living in a physical body with principles of psychology and spirituality to create a truly complete picture of how to achieve happiness and the body you've always wanted. Truly inspiring, and filled with practical tools to help you on your journey, Happy Calories Don't Count is a little book that packs a big punch!

About the Author
Weight-loss expert and founder of Happy Calories Don't Count, Carmela Ramaglia, challenges the basic assumptions of the diet and exercise paradigm of weight loss. By revealing the fundamental flaw of this traditional model, Carmela illustrates how the idea of "diet and exercise" actually keeps most people from achieving their weight-loss goals. Based on the knowledge, experience and insights she discovered in her own personal struggle with diet and exercise, Carmela offers a revolutionary new paradigm for weight-loss that delivers the critical missing element between weight-loss efforts and successful, long-term results. Innovative new perspective on successful diet and exercise.
By J. Stewart
Happy Calories Don't Count brings new light to the limitations of the calories in/calories out concept of weight loss. Carmela Ramaglia shares the experiences that led her to rethink what makes an effective long term solution to getting (and keeping) the body you've always wanted. Instead of obsessing over what others stress as "the right kind" of food and exercise, she encourages a deep connection with your body and personal state of being. Carmela states that we only want anything because we think having it will make us happy. She makes a strong case that people who are miserable obsessing over counting calories and worrying about the right kind of exercise will get only limited results and ultimately quit altogether. Happy Calories Don't Count outlines an approach that removes the painful association many of us have to diet and exercise and introduces a simple steering method to keep us joyfully connected to our bodies. One that will perpetually improve our body, our state of being, and the pleasure of being alive. Her own painful experiences that led to her discovering this new paradigm make it altogether more satisfying that she bring this message to anyone struggling with body issues. I think anyone who has not found results in their own weight loss efforts will find Happy Calories Don't Count inspiring, thought provoking, and the first step to fundamentally changing the way they relate to food and exercise. It changed mine.
